Brewing Method
-
Classic: 3g per 200ml | 75°C | 1–2 min. Bright, grassy, and refreshing with a slight nutty undertone.
-
Gongfu: 5g per 100ml | 80°C | 15s, 20s, 30s, 40s. Enhances the vegetal sweetness and vibrant green color.
-
Cold Brew: 10g per 1L cold water. Steep for 3–4 hours. Very clean, low bitterness, and incredibly cooling.
FAQ
What is China Sencha green tea?
China Sencha is a green tea produced in China using a style similar to Japanese sencha. The tea is known for its fresh aroma, smooth vegetal flavor, and bright green liquor.
What does China Sencha tea taste like?
China Sencha green tea has a fresh and slightly vegetal flavor with mild sweetness. The taste is smooth, clean, and refreshing with light grassy notes.
How do you brew China Sencha green tea?
To brew China Sencha green tea, use water heated to around 75–80°C. Add about 3–4 grams of loose leaf tea per 200 ml of water and steep for 1–2 minutes.
Does China Sencha contain caffeine?
Yes, China Sencha green tea contains caffeine because it is made from the Camellia sinensis tea plant. The caffeine level is moderate and provides a gentle energy boost.
Where does China Sencha tea come from?
China Sencha tea is produced in China using green tea processing methods inspired by Japanese sencha. Chinese green tea regions produce a wide variety of fresh and aromatic teas.
How many times can China Sencha tea be brewed?
China Sencha green tea can usually be brewed 2–3 times. Each infusion reveals slightly different layers of flavor while maintaining a fresh and smooth taste.
Description
The Essence of Green Tea Purity China Sencha is a celebration of freshness. Unlike Japanese Sencha, which is purely steamed, this Chinese variety is often finished with a light pan-firing, creating a beautiful balance between botanical vividness and a gentle, savory sweetness.
